https://www.hackerrank.com/challenges/queue-using-two-stacks/problem The above question requires implementing a queue using two stacks. So what I am supposed to do is answer to 3 types of queries
- Enqueue
- Dequeue
- Print Top
My code is as follows: /*
#include <iostream>
#include <stack>
using namespace std;
class QueueTwoStack{
stack<int> s1;
stack<int> s2;
public:
void enqueue(int x);
void dequeue();
int Front();
};
void QueueTwoStack::enqueue(int x){ //ENQUEUE
while(!s1.empty()){
s2.push(s1.top());
s1.pop();
}
s1.push(x);
while(!s2.empty()){
s1.push(s2.top());
s2.pop();
}
}
void QueueTwoStack::dequeue(){ //DEQUEUE
if(!s1.empty())
s1.pop();
}
int QueueTwoStack::Front(){ //RETURN FRONT
return s1.top();
}
int main() {
QueueTwoStack Queue;
int q,ch,x;
cin>>q;
while(q--){
cin>>ch;
if(ch==2)
Queue.dequeue();
else if(ch==3)
cout<<Queue.Front()<<endl;
else if(ch==1){
cin>>x;
Queue.enqueue(x);
}
}
return 0;
}
*/
Now This Code passes 25% of test cases and giving "Time Limit Exceeded" verdict. Any Help on inefficiency in code or approach?. Also I want to ask that does using classes slow down the code?
